A plan position indicator is a projection of radar data onto the earth's
surface, generated from a single scan (scan) with project_as_ppi(), a
polar volume (pvol) with integrate_to_ppi() or multiple plan position
indicators (ppi) with composite_ppi(). A plan position indicator (ppi)
object is a list containing:
radar: Radar identifier.
datetime: Nominal time of the volume to which the scan belongs in UTC.
data: A sp::SpatialGridDataFrame containing the georeferenced data.
See summary.param() for commonly available parameters, such as DBZH.
geo: List of the scan's geographic properties (see the geo element in
summary.scan()), with two additional properties:
bbox: Bounding box for the plan position indicator in decimal degrees.
merged: Logical. Flag to indicate if a plan position indicator is a
composite of multiple scans. TRUE if generated with integrate_to_ppi()
or composite_ppi().
For is.ppi(): TRUE for an object of class ppi, otherwise
FALSE.
For dim.ppi(): number of parameters (param), x and y pixels in a
plan position indicator (ppi).

# Project a scan as a ppi
ppi <- project_as_ppi(example_scan)
# Check if it is an object of class ppi
is.ppi(ppi)
# Get summary info
ppi # Same as summary(ppi) or print(ppi)
# Get dimensions
dim(ppi)
